After the embarrassment of losing to the great nations of Namibia and the USA in T20, 2022 starts for us with 3 WCQ against the West Indies in Jamaica, over the next week. BT will show them live, with no fans in attendance. We lost all 3 games when we were last there in 2020, but almost won the second one. If we can win one of these games, we still have a chance of qualifying directly for next year's World Cup in India.
